What your child develops
Fitness Boxing 2 helps children develop hand-eye coordination, fine motor skills, and reaction time through rhythmic exercises. It encourages physical activity in a fun and engaging way, allowing for both solo and cooperative play. The adaptive challenge ensures that workouts can be tailored to individual fitness levels.

About this game
Work out at home and punch to the beat. Jab, uppercut, dodge, and more to catchy pop tunes in this rhythmic boxing game.
